Understanding DAWs in Cinematic Soundtrack Production
Digital Audio Workstations (DAWs) have revolutionized cinematic soundtrack production. These powerful tools allow us to manipulate sound with unparalleled precision. DAWs offer a range of features essential for mastering cinematic soundtracks in large-scale productions.
Core Features of DAWs
- Multitrack Recording
We can record multiple audio tracks simultaneously, enabling complex layering of sounds. - MIDI Sequencing
DAWs support MIDI sequencing, letting us integrate electronic instruments seamlessly with traditional audio. - Real-Time Editing
Real-time editing features allow us to test and adjust sound instantly, improving workflow efficiency. - Advanced Effects Processing
With built-in effects and plugins, we can apply EQ, reverb, compression, and other effects to enhance the soundtrack.
Compatibility and Integration
Modern DAWs integrate easily with other production software. This interoperability streamlines the workflow, allowing us to import and export audio files between different platforms without losing quality. DAWs also support various file formats and sample rates, ensuring compatibility with other tools used in cinematic production.
Customizable User Interface
DAWs offer customizable interfaces that cater to the specific needs of sound engineers and composers. We can tailor the workspace to highlight frequently used tools, making the process more intuitive and efficient.
Automation and Presets
Automation features let us create dynamic changes in volume, panning, and effects throughout the soundtrack. Presets provide a starting point for complex processes, saving time and ensuring consistency.
By leveraging these features, we achieve a polished final product that enhances the storytelling aspect of cinematic productions.
Key Features of DAWs for Large-Scale Productions
Digital Audio Workstations (DAWs) offer powerful features that cater specifically to the demands of mastering cinematic soundtracks in large-scale productions.
High-Resolution Audio Support
DAWs provide high-resolution audio support, essential for achieving pristine soundtrack quality. They handle sample rates up to 192 kHz and bit depths of 24 bits or higher. This quality ensures that every subtle nuance is captured, preserving the full dynamic range needed for cinematic soundscapes. High-resolution support also facilitates seamless integration with professional audio formats, maintaining fidelity from recording to final output.
Advanced Automation Tools
DAWs include advanced automation tools to streamline complex tasks. These tools enable precise control over various parameters like volume, panning, and effects. Automation curves allow for dynamic changes over time, crucial for enhancing emotional impact. For instance, sound engineers can automate volume fades in an action sequence or gradually increase reverb during a dramatic scene, ensuring consistency and precision throughout the production.
Integration with External Hardware
Integration with external hardware is a critical feature of DAWs. They support various audio interfaces, control surfaces, and MIDI controllers. This capability allows us to utilize physical gear alongside digital tools, enhancing flexibility. For example, using control surfaces, we can manipulate multiple tracks simultaneously, offering tactile feedback that improves accuracy and workflow efficiency.
These key features amplify our ability to produce high-quality, immersive cinematic soundtracks, bridging the gap between technical capability and creative expression.
Best DAWs for Mastering Cinematic Soundtracks
Mastering cinematic soundtracks requires the right tools. We explore the top Digital Audio Workstations (DAWs) renowned for their capabilities in large-scale productions.
Pro Tools
Pro Tools dominates in professional audio production. It’s revered for its powerful editing features, high-resolution support, and extensive plugin library. It excels in managing sessions with high track counts, making it ideal for complex soundtracks. Additionally, Pro Tools integrates seamlessly with various hardware, enhancing workflow efficiency. Its advanced automation tools allow precise control over audio dynamics, essential for achieving the right emotional impact.
Logic Pro
Logic Pro is a favorite among composers. Offering a robust suite of creative tools, it includes a vast sound library, advanced MIDI sequencing, and comprehensive mixing capabilities. Logic Pro’s flexibility in handling both MIDI and audio makes it a compelling choice for cinematic soundtracks. The user-friendly interface and integration with Apple hardware provide a seamless production experience. With its real-time editing and automation features, Logic Pro enables meticulous sound design.
Cubase
Cubase is known for its versatility and extensive feature set. Its intuitive user interface and advanced MIDI capabilities make it popular for scoring. Cubase supports high-resolution audio and offers a wide range of virtual instruments and effects. It’s particularly strong in sound design, offering tools that cater to intricate soundtracks. The DAW’s robust automation features and compatibility with various plugins and hardware streamline the production process, ensuring high-quality output.
Essential Techniques for Mastering Soundtracks
Mastering cinematic soundtracks involves several critical techniques to achieve a polished, immersive auditory experience. Below, we explore the key techniques essential for mastering soundtracks in large-scale productions.
EQ and Compression
Applying EQ and compression shapes the overall sound and balances frequency ranges. EQ adjusts the tonal balance by boosting or attenuating specific frequencies. This makes each element clear and cohesive. Compression controls the dynamic range by reducing volume peaks, ensuring consistent loudness. Proper EQ and compression enhance clarity and impact, making the soundtrack more engaging and professional.
Spatial Effects and Panning
Spatial effects and panning create a sense of depth and space, essential for immersive soundscapes. Reverb and delay simulate different environments, adding realism. Panning positions sounds across the stereo field, giving each element a distinct location. Effective use of spatial effects and panning immerses the audience, making the soundtrack feel expansive and dynamic.
Dynamic Range Management
Managing dynamic range ensures the soundtrack maintains emotional impact without losing detail. Limiting and maximizing are key processes to prevent clipping and maintain loudness. Balancing quieter and louder sections keeps the listener engaged without sudden jarring changes. Proper dynamic range management delivers a compelling, balanced auditory experience.
